About International College of Beauty Arts & Sciences

Set in Los Angeles creative neighborhoods, International College of Beauty Arts & Sciences is known for hands-on learning that blends technical craft with health, safety, and the business side of client service. Coursework moves from fundamentals to polished technique, with practice on a wide range of looks. The vibe is collaborative and upbeat, the kind of place where feedback is direct, mentors are accessible, and students push each other to get better.

Learning spaces mirror working studios, with salon-floor practice areas, product stations, and quieter nooks for study and prep. Students find advising that emphasizes licensure readiness, portfolio development, and professional etiquette. Student life typically includes peer showcases, pop-up practice sessions, and low-key creative meetups. And being in LA helps. The surrounding beauty, fashion, and entertainment scenes bring guest pros, shadowing opportunities, and real client experience. The college has a reputation for practical career connections and a tight-knit, service-first culture.

What academic programs and degree levels does International College of Beauty Arts & Sciences offer?

International College of Beauty Arts & Sciences (ICBAS) offers 4 academic programs across 1 major fields of study, with available degree levels: Certificate (1-2 yrs), Other Award.

Most popular program areas include:

  • Hospitality Management, Culinary Arts and Personal Care (4 programs)

Data based on IPEDS program completions for 2023-2024 academic year. Numbers reflect programs where students graduated, not all offered programs.

What financial aid and scholarships are available at International College of Beauty Arts & Sciences?

International College of Beauty Arts & Sciences (ICBAS) provides financial aid to 25% of first-time, full-time students, with average grants of $4,775 and average loans of $5,737.

Average financial aid amounts by type:

  • Pell grants: $4,605
  • Institutional grants: $1,542
  • Federal loans: $5,737

The university supports 26 students with grants and 23 students with loans annually.

Data based on IPEDS for 2022-2023 academic year. Financial aid amounts and percentages may vary by program, enrollment status, and individual circumstances.

What is the average salary for International College of Beauty Arts & Sciences graduates?

International College of Beauty Arts & Sciences (ICBAS) graduates earn a median salary of $14,587 after 6 years.

Data based on IPEDS for 2022-2023 academic year. Salary data reflects graduates who received federal financial aid (approximately 60% of all graduates). Actual earnings may vary significantly based on program, location, and individual circumstances.
